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
33 Albemarle St. Mayfair, London, United Kingdom, W1S 4BP
69 Chatsworth Rd. Hackney, London, United Kingdom, E5 0LH
63 Ham St. Richmond, Greater London, United Kingdom, TW10 7HW
115 Endwell Rd., Brockley Cross Lewisham, Greater London, United Kingdom, SE4 2LY
67 High St. Beckenham, Greater London, United Kingdom, SE20 7HW
717 North Circular Rd. Brent, Greater London, United Kingdom, NW2 7AH
455 Hackney Rd. Bethnal Green, London, United Kingdom, E2 9DY
12-15 Hanger Green Ealing, London, United Kingdom, W5 3AY
Unit 2A, Abbey Industrial Estate, Willow Ln. Mitcham, Greater London, United Kingdom, CR4 4NA
117 Boston Rd. Hanwell, London, United Kingdom, W7 3SB